Shadows Workout CD18+
Many thanks for purchasing my latest workout.
In the same format as previously I have concentrated on a more varied selection of material which I believe should appeal to "Shads" players.
I was recently reminded of some of the late John Barry's many instrumentals and in particular his version of "The Magnificent Seven" theme - as a result I had to record a backing track for this and have included two separate mixes with and without the second guitar part.
From the Ventures back catalogue I have provided backing tracks for "Perfidia" and "Theme from a Summer Place".
From the more rare but I believe interesting instrumentals I have recorded backing tracks for the Fentones version of "The Breeze and I" and the British "Eagles" version of "Stranger on the Shore".
In this category I have included a backing track for The Shadows version of "You've Got To Have Heart" - as far as I am aware no studio recordings were ever made of this and I took this arrangement from a recording of a live TV performance made by The Shadows in the '60s.
On the mainstream Shadows side I have recorded backing tracks for "Hey Jude", "You'll Never Walk Alone" and "March to Drina" on this particular track I have included mixes with and without the second guitar part.
Again, many thanks to Dave Prickett for his unending keyboard skills and unswerving attention to detail.
Well I suppose I had better go and plan the next CD - any suggestions are more than welcome.

Echo Settings:
Title | Pickup | Q2/Q20 | Zoom RFX2000/2200 | G7.1ut |
---|---|---|---|---|
Hey Jude | Bridge | 0-27 | 18 | U3-1 |
You'll Never Walk Alone | Bridge | 0-27 | 18 | U3-1 |
Theme from a Summer Place | Bridge | 0-27 | 18 | U3-1 |
Detour | Neck + Bridge | 1-66 | 45 | U9-2 |
The Magnificent Seven | Neck + Bridge | 1-66 | 45 | U9-2 |
Perfidia | Neck + Bridge | 1-66 | 45 | U9-2 |
The Breeze and I | Bridge | 1-66 | 45 | U9-2 |
Stranger on the Shore | Neck + Bridge | 1-66 | 45 | U9-2 |
You've Got To Have Heart | Neck | 0-00 | 11 | U2-2 |
March To Drina | Neck/Middle/Bridge | 0-00 | 11 | U2-2 |
